Well, BMW has had di coupled with turbocharging since 2007 model year. According to my driving regime, the ecu/olm is telling me I can go nearly 18 k before the next oil change on my turbo di 535.

But yes di does increase fuel dilution. I believe the reason BMW deliberately runs the oil so hot (230-250 F) is to volatilize or drive off some of the fuel dilution.
